This commit is contained in:
Jakub Jelinek 2013-12-09 19:10:08 +01:00
parent 107d671c75
commit 1984ee75ad
4 changed files with 1567 additions and 6 deletions

1
.gitignore vendored
View File

@ -87,3 +87,4 @@
/gcc-4.8.1-20130920.tar.bz2 /gcc-4.8.1-20130920.tar.bz2
/gcc-4.8.2-20131017.tar.bz2 /gcc-4.8.2-20131017.tar.bz2
/gcc-4.8.2-20131111.tar.bz2 /gcc-4.8.2-20131111.tar.bz2
/gcc-4.8.2-20131209.tar.bz2

File diff suppressed because it is too large Load Diff

View File

@ -1,9 +1,9 @@
%global DATE 20131111 %global DATE 20131209
%global SVNREV 204664 %global SVNREV 205813
%global gcc_version 4.8.2 %global gcc_version 4.8.2
# Note, gcc_release must be integer, if you want to add suffixes to # Note, gcc_release must be integer, if you want to add suffixes to
# %{release}, append them after %{gcc_release} on Release: line. # %{release}, append them after %{gcc_release} on Release: line.
%global gcc_release 4 %global gcc_release 5
%global _unpackaged_files_terminate_build 0 %global _unpackaged_files_terminate_build 0
%global multilib_64_archs sparc64 ppc64 s390x x86_64 %global multilib_64_archs sparc64 ppc64 s390x x86_64
%ifarch %{ix86} x86_64 ia64 ppc ppc64 alpha %ifarch %{ix86} x86_64 ia64 ppc ppc64 alpha
@ -202,6 +202,7 @@ Patch1001: fastjar-0.97-len1.patch
Patch1002: fastjar-0.97-filename0.patch Patch1002: fastjar-0.97-filename0.patch
Patch1003: fastjar-CVE-2010-0831.patch Patch1003: fastjar-CVE-2010-0831.patch
Patch1004: fastjar-man.patch Patch1004: fastjar-man.patch
Patch1005: fastjar-0.97-aarch64-config.patch
Patch1100: isl-%{isl_version}-aarch64-config.patch Patch1100: isl-%{isl_version}-aarch64-config.patch
@ -812,6 +813,7 @@ tar xzf %{SOURCE4}
%patch1002 -p0 -b .fastjar-0.97-filename0~ %patch1002 -p0 -b .fastjar-0.97-filename0~
%patch1003 -p0 -b .fastjar-CVE-2010-0831~ %patch1003 -p0 -b .fastjar-CVE-2010-0831~
%patch1004 -p0 -b .fastjar-man~ %patch1004 -p0 -b .fastjar-man~
%patch1005 -p0 -b .fastjar-0.97-aarch64-config~
%if %{bootstrap_java} %if %{bootstrap_java}
tar xjf %{SOURCE10} tar xjf %{SOURCE10}
@ -1317,9 +1319,9 @@ sed -i -e 's/lib: /&%%{static:%%eJava programs cannot be linked statically}/' \
$FULLPATH/libgcj.spec $FULLPATH/libgcj.spec
%endif %endif
mv %{buildroot}%{_prefix}/lib/libgfortran.spec $FULLPATH/ mv %{buildroot}%{_prefix}/%{_lib}/libgfortran.spec $FULLPATH/
%if %{build_libitm} %if %{build_libitm}
mv %{buildroot}%{_prefix}/lib/libitm.spec $FULLPATH/ mv %{buildroot}%{_prefix}/%{_lib}/libitm.spec $FULLPATH/
%endif %endif
mkdir -p %{buildroot}/%{_lib} mkdir -p %{buildroot}/%{_lib}
@ -3019,6 +3021,28 @@ fi
%{_prefix}/libexec/gcc/%{gcc_target_platform}/%{gcc_version}/plugin %{_prefix}/libexec/gcc/%{gcc_target_platform}/%{gcc_version}/plugin
%changelog %changelog
* Mon Dec 9 2013 Jakub Jelinek <jakub@redhat.com> 4.8.2-5
- update from the 4.8 branch
- PRs ada/59382, bootstrap/57683, c++/58162, c++/59031, c++/59032,
c++/59044, c++/59052, c++/59268, c++/59297, c/59280, c/59351,
fortran/57445, fortran/58099, fortran/58471, fortran/58771,
middle-end/58742, middle-end/58941, middle-end/58956,
middle-end/59011, middle-end/59037, middle-end/59138,
rtl-optimization/58726, target/50751, target/51244, target/56788,
target/58854, target/58864, target/59021, target/59088,
target/59101, target/59153, target/59163, target/59207,
target/59343, target/59405, tree-optimization/57517,
tree-optimization/58137, tree-optimization/58143,
tree-optimization/58653, tree-optimization/58794,
tree-optimization/59014, tree-optimization/59047,
tree-optimization/59139, tree-optimization/59164,
tree-optimization/59288, tree-optimization/59330,
tree-optimization/59334, tree-optimization/59358,
tree-optimization/59388
- aarch64 gcj enablement (#1023789)
- look for libgfortran.spec and libitm.spec in %%{_lib} rather than lib
subdirs (#1023789)
* Mon Nov 11 2013 Jakub Jelinek <jakub@redhat.com> 4.8.2-4 * Mon Nov 11 2013 Jakub Jelinek <jakub@redhat.com> 4.8.2-4
- update from the 4.8 branch - update from the 4.8 branch
- PRs plugins/52872, regression/58985, target/59034 - PRs plugins/52872, regression/58985, target/59034

View File

@ -1,4 +1,4 @@
be78a47bd82523250eb3e91646db5b3d cloog-0.18.0.tar.gz be78a47bd82523250eb3e91646db5b3d cloog-0.18.0.tar.gz
2659f09c2e43ef8b7d4406321753f1b2 fastjar-0.97.tar.gz 2659f09c2e43ef8b7d4406321753f1b2 fastjar-0.97.tar.gz
e1af4eb9a73c65f58c3c4493d3a58472 gcc-4.8.2-20131111.tar.bz2 b612421ddf9869af0cd14c1844b078b1 gcc-4.8.2-20131209.tar.bz2
bce1586384d8635a76d2f017fb067cd2 isl-0.11.1.tar.bz2 bce1586384d8635a76d2f017fb067cd2 isl-0.11.1.tar.bz2